Ford gets California approval for testing self-driving cars on roads
1265
DETROIT (Reuters) -- Ford Motor Co. said it procured a license from Ca to start examining its self-driving vehicle on community streets from next year.
Ford, which stated on Tuesday it'll examine its Ford Fusion hybrid-car, joins businesses including Alphabet Inc.'s Google to Volkswagen A G in screening the fast growing self-driving technologies.
Other car-makers currently accepted by Ca contain Honda Motor Co., Daimler AG, Tesla Motors Inc., Nissan Motor Co. and BMW AG.
Ca is one of a handful of states, as well as Michigan, Florida and Nevada, that have handed laws enabling screening of self-driving vehicles on public streets.
Google along with other automotive manufacturers and providers have stated the technologies to create self-driving vehicles ought to prepare yourself by 2020.
